vps教程如何搭建vps服务器

不及物动词 其他 32

回复

共3条回复 我来回复
  • worktile的头像
    worktile
    Worktile官方账号
    评论

    搭建VPS服务器的教程

    VPS(Virtual Private Server)是一种虚拟化技术,可以让用户在一台物理服务器上创建多个独立的虚拟服务器。搭建VPS服务器可以为个人或企业提供一个稳定、安全的网络环境。下面是搭建VPS服务器的教程。

    一、选择合适的VPS提供商
    首先,你需要选择一个合适的VPS提供商。在选择VPS提供商时,你需要考虑以下几个因素:

    1. 价格:不同的VPS提供商价格可能有所不同,你需要根据自己的需求和预算进行选择。
    2. 可用性和可靠性:选择一个具备良好的网络可用性和高可靠性的VPS提供商,确保你的网站或应用能够持续正常运行。
    3. 技术支持:确保VPS提供商提供24/7的技术支持,以便在遇到问题时能够及时解决。

    二、购买VPS服务器
    一旦你选择了合适的VPS提供商,就可以购买VPS服务器了。你需要根据自己的需求选择VPS的配置(例如CPU、内存、存储空间等)。VPS提供商会向你提供一个IP地址和登录凭证,它们将用于后续的服务器配置。

    三、设置VPS服务器
    购买VPS服务器后,你需要对其进行基本的配置,使其能够正常工作。以下是设置VPS服务器的基本步骤:

    1. 远程登录:使用SSH(Secure Shell)工具连接到VPS服务器。在Windows操作系统中,你可以使用PuTTY等工具进行远程登录。在Linux或Mac操作系统中,你可以使用终端进行远程登录。
    2. 更新操作系统:执行以下命令,将操作系统更新到最新版本:
      sudo apt update // 对于基于Debian的Linux发行版
      sudo yum update // 对于基于Red Hat的Linux发行版
    3. 安装必要的软件:根据你的需求安装必要的软件,例如Nginx或Apache、MySQL等。
      sudo apt install nginx // 安装Nginx
      sudo apt install mysql-server // 安装MySQL服务器
    4. 配置网络和防火墙:配置VPS服务器的网络和防火墙设置,以确保网络安全。
      sudo ufw allow ssh // 允许SSH连接
      sudo ufw enable // 启用防火墙

    四、配置VPS服务器
    在设置完基本配置后,还需要对VPS服务器进行进一步的配置,以满足自己的需求。以下是一些常见的配置内容:

    1. 网络配置:设置IP地址、子网掩码、网关等网络参数。
    2. 磁盘划分:根据需要对磁盘进行划分,例如创建根分区、数据分区等。
    3. 配置域名:如果你有自己的域名,可以将其绑定到VPS服务器上。
    4. 安全配置:配置SSH访问、防火墙规则等,加强服务器的安全性。
    5. 数据备份:设置定期备份服务器数据,以防止数据丢失。

    五、优化和维护VPS服务器
    一旦VPS服务器配置完成,你需要进行一些优化和维护工作,以确保服务器的稳定性和安全性。

    1. 优化性能:根据服务器的实际情况,调整内存、CPU等资源的分配,以提高服务器的性能。
    2. 定期更新和升级:定期更新操作系统和软件包,确保服务器的安全性和稳定性。
    3. 监控服务器:使用监控工具监控服务器的性能指标、网络流量等情况,及时发现并解决问题。
    4. 定期备份:定期备份服务器的数据和配置文件,以备不时之需。

    总结
    搭建VPS服务器需要选择合适的VPS提供商,购买合适的VPS服务器,并进行基本配置和进一步配置。此外,还需要进行优化和维护工作,以保证服务器的稳定性和安全性。希望本教程能帮助你顺利搭建VPS服务器。

    1年前 0条评论
  • fiy的头像
    fiy
    Worktile&PingCode市场小伙伴
    评论

    要搭建一个VPS服务器,您可以按照以下步骤进行操作:

    1.选择合适的VPS供应商:首先,您需要选择一个可靠的VPS供应商。您可以通过使用搜索引擎来寻找一些受欢迎的VPS供应商,并根据用户评价和价格来进行筛选。

    2.选择适合您需求的操作系统:一旦您选择了VPS供应商,您需要选择一个适合您需求的操作系统。常见的选择包括Linux(如Ubuntu、CentOS、Debian)和Windows服务器操作系统。

    3.购买VPS服务器:在选择了操作系统之后,您可以根据您的需求选择购买合适的VPS服务器。这包括选择服务器硬件规格(例如,处理器、内存、存储空间)和网络带宽。

    4.配置VPS服务器:购买VPS服务器后,您将获得一个远程登录的“root”或“admin”权限。使用SSH(对于Linux)或远程桌面(对于Windows)连接到VPS服务器。然后,您可以根据需要进行配置,如安装软件、设置防火墙、配置网络等。

    5.安全设置和备份:保护您的VPS服务器是非常重要的。您可以通过设置防火墙、使用强密码、更新操作系统和软件程序等方式来增强服务器的安全性。此外,定期备份服务器上的重要数据也是一个明智的选择。

    6.配置Web服务器和数据库:如果您计划在VPS服务器上托管网站,您需要安装和配置适当的Web服务器(如Apache或Nginx)和数据库服务器(如MySQL或PostgreSQL)。这将允许您在服务器上运行和管理网站和数据库。

    7.管理和维护VPS服务器:一旦您的VPS服务器正常运行,您需要定期进行管理和维护。这包括升级操作系统和软件程序、监控服务器性能、解决问题和故障排除等。

    总结起来,搭建VPS服务器需要选择合适的供应商、选择适合您需求的操作系统,购买并配置VPS服务器,设置安全和备份措施,配置Web服务器和数据库,以及定期管理和维护服务器。在进行这些步骤时,建议您参考相关的在线教程或咨询VPS供应商的支持团队。

    1年前 0条评论
  • 不及物动词的头像
    不及物动词
    这个人很懒,什么都没有留下~
    评论

    搭建VPS服务器是一个复杂的过程,需要具备一定的系统管理知识和技能。下面是一个简要的VPS搭建教程,包括选择合适的VPS提供商、购买和设置VPS服务器、配置服务器和安全性优化等步骤。

    1. 选择合适的VPS提供商
      在市场上有很多VPS提供商可供选择。选择合适的VPS提供商时,需要考虑以下几个因素:
    • 价格:根据个人需求确定预算,选择性价比较高的提供商。
    • 可用性和稳定性:选择拥有高可用性和稳定服务的提供商,以确保服务器的稳定运行。
    • 安全性:提供商应该提供良好的网络和数据安全保护措施,以防止黑客入侵和数据泄露。
    1. 购买和设置VPS服务器
    • 在所选择的VPS提供商的官网上注册账号。
    • 浏览提供商的VPS套餐,选择适合自己需求的套餐。
    • 进行购买和支付。
    • 提供商会向你提供VPS服务器的IP地址、用户名和密码等信息,用于登录服务器。
    1. 配置服务器
    • 登录VPS服务器
    • 更新操作系统和软件包:通过命令行工具或者面板来更新系统和软件包,保持服务器的安全和稳定。
    • 安装Web服务器:如Apache、Nginx等,用于托管网站或应用。
    • 安装数据库:如MySQL、PostgreSQL等,用于存储和管理数据。
    • 安装和配置其他必要的软件:如PHP、Python等,根据需要安装和配置其他必要的软件和语言。
    • 设置域名解析:将域名解析到VPS服务器的IP地址上,以便通过域名来访问服务器。
    1. 安全性优化
    • 更新系统补丁:及时更新操作系统和软件包中的补丁,修复已知的安全漏洞,提高系统的安全性。
    • 配置防火墙:使用防火墙限制网络流量,只允许必要的端口开放,并配置入侵检测系统(IDS)进行实时监控和预警。
    • 安装反恶意软件工具:如Fail2ban,监控系统日志并屏蔽恶意登录尝试。
    • 使用安全的密码和认证方式:为服务器和用户账号设置强密码,并使用SSH key等安全的认证方式。
    • 定期备份:定期备份服务器上的数据,以防止数据丢失。

    需要注意的是,搭建VPS服务器不仅仅是以上这些步骤,还涉及到很多细节和技术问题。如果你对VPS服务器不太熟悉,建议参考官方文档或咨询专业人士,以确保服务器的正常运行。

    1年前 0条评论
注册PingCode 在线客服
站长微信
站长微信
电话联系

400-800-1024

工作日9:30-21:00在线

分享本页
返回顶部